here's all the ingredients you will need
some cantro salt fish sauce Sriracha
hoisting sauce Rock Sugar you'll need
about 10 staranise one cinnamon stick
four to five bay leaves about a teaspoon
of finel seeds you'll need two medium
onions about 6 oz of Ginger and we're
doing a beef soup base today so we have
3 lbs of oxtail you can also use beef
leg bones we've got about a pound of
thinly sliced beef and you want this
sliced as thin as possible and I love
using brisket because it gives me a nice
balance of leing and fatty meat you'll
need some lime rice noodles I prefer
this brand and for veggies we have some
Sprouts some green onions and you'll
need a big big pot to Stew everything in
first thing we're going to do is roast
our onions and ginger all you got to do
is take your onion and just cut that in
half this one's massive this one like
the size of my
head then take your Ginger and just cut
it into big
chunks put them all in a roasting sheet
just take the outer peel off because
it's going to crumple and leave a mess
in your
soup preheat your oven on broil go ahead
and slice that in that's going to be in
there for about 20 minutes and make sure
to flip it over at the 10-minute Mark
what that's going to do is bring out all
the magical oniony gingery flavor it's
going to make your soup fantastic while
the onion and Ginger is roasting take
your pot add your bones in my case deox
tail cover the bones with water doesn't
matter how much as long as you cover it
and we're going to bring this to a
boil just going to turn my onions and
gingers over so they don't burn you just
don't want them to
Blacken 20 minutes up set it aside and
let it cool and before you put this into
your soup just get rid of some of the
brins outer shelves my oxtail is boiling
and you can see all the scum floating on
top we're going to get rid of all that
we're going to clean the bones before we
start prepping our broth and a lot of
you might be freaking out right now
because I am dumping all this out you
see all this scum floating on top and
then I'm top of the meat and the bones
we're going to get rid of all that look
at this make sure you clean all that
scum out of your pot before you start
making your broth and also look at the
bones look how dirty this is you got to
clean all the bones off so your soup
comes out nice and clear and honestly
just about 10 minutes of boiling this is
not going to you're not going to lose
that much flavor but if you don't do
this your soup is going to come out very
cloudy and it's not going to be that
good so guys I want you to fight your
instincts clean the scum after you you
rinse your pot add two gallons of
water adding your clean oxtail
bones put it back onto the stove and
bring that to a boil get a pan heated up
on low to your spices in and just cook
it for a few minutes to bring out its
flavor after a few minutes the star is a
nier the uh bay leaves are leafier and
you can take this and put it inside a
cheesecloth where you can put inside a
spice bag and that's where you're going
to toss into your
[Music]
broth pot is boiling again you see
there's more scum now floating on the
surface what you need to do is become a
scum fighting machine all right so
whenever you see scum get it out of
there now that this is boiled turn this
on low bring it to a simmer and we are
going to go ahead and add our spice bag
1 in of yellow Rock Sugar you can use
regular sugar but the taste is going to
be just sweet and kind of flat the
flavor profile of yellow Rock sugar is
much deeper in goes your onions and
ginger that you are roasting in the oven
2 tbspoon of salt and this this is
really important here this is the
essence of the broth just remember do
not skimp on the fish sauce get a good
quality fish sauce actually I have no
idea whether this is a I think this is a
good brand this is the most expensive um
brand they had in the store but this
smells really rotten so I think that's a
good thing and you're going to need
about half a cup of that give it a
little
mix and we're going to let that simmer
for about 5 to 6 hours uncovered and
what you got to do like I mentioned you
got to keep checking back for the scum
we will not allow scum to overtake our
street War
F Well the soup looks and smells good
what we're going to do next is we're
going to string everything we're going
to take out um all the onions ginger in
the bones and the meat we're going to
take the meat off the bones and then put
the meat back in because come on we're
not going to waste the meat look how
tendered that meat is right there can't
wa to bite into that look how Yeezy that
meat is coming off all right the Asian
side of me took over when I see a B I
got to GW on
it oh that is gelatinous delicious
that's a little appetizer would a lot of
people like to do after the broth is
ready is strain it in a cheesecloth and
you could do that definitely also
there's going to be a layer of fat
floating to the top of this broth and
what you can do if you want is to leave
it overnight in the fridge and the fat
will separate you can remove it that way
for me I'm really hungry right now so
I'm just going to use my Ladle here and
just bypass the upper layer of fat and
just dig into this
broth oh that's hot M that's good though
wow um what you can do here as well is
this is where you adjust your your
saltiness preference if you want your
broth more salty you can add more fish
sauce in there you can add more salt in
there but for me I don't want it too
salty because I'm going to add some
Sriracha in and uh I'm going to add some
hoiston sauce in there
later and you can just lay the uh thinly
sliced beef on the noodles itself
because the broth is hot enough we're
it's going to cook it I like a ton of
soup we're just going to chop up some
cilantro some green onions and we'll cut
up a
lime some basil and this is just
personal preference you don't need to
add it if you don't want to some lime
squeeze that in there and definitely
chunks of oxtail meat
finally last not least some bean sprouts
to give a little crunch there you go
